Transaction 62e0ef320d2d70c720b16207e8ce030a1bec464324c402371381a0552bd54505
1 Input
1 Output
-
62e0ef320d2d70c720b16207e8ce030a1bec464324c402371381a0552bd54505:0
- value
- 811611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07fcc05a4540a429c328d74f11f33ea72e4f130d OP_EQUAL
- address
- 32RFSMqmuEfU4rsSqv96WYS1FnYBNxb1J3